What is Tally ERP 9?

Tally ERP 9 is a software that does accounting tasks. It has been around in India for many years now. Even now, several firms are using it.

It can be used for:

  • Recording day-to-day transactions
  • Creating invoices
  • GST management
  • Expense tracking
  • Financial reporting

It gained popularity due to its simplicity and usefulness.

A lot of accountants began their careers on Tally ERP 9.

What is Tally Prime?

Tally Prime is the newest version of Tally software. It is an advanced version of Tally ERP 9.

It includes all the functions of the old version. However, it is more efficient, more convenient, and more straightforward.

It has been designed to avoid confusion and save time.

New businesses prefer using Tally Prime nowadays.

Main Differences Between Tally ERP 9 and Tally Prime

Let us understand the difference between the two.

 

1. Usability

Tally ERP 9 is useful but complicated for novices.

Tally Prime is easy to use and understand.

Any new user can comprehend it easily.

Menus are clear. Procedures are simple.

This enables students to learn quickly.

 

2. Navigation

Sometimes, users find navigation difficult in Tally ERP 9.

Navigation in Tally Prime is easy and convenient.

Users can navigate seamlessly from one screen to another.

This helps save time.

 

3. Reporting

Although Tally ERP 9 generates reports, they are not always easy to understand.

Tally Prime generates clear and organised reports.

Students can understand profits, losses, and expenditures without difficulty.

 

4. Data Entry

Data entry involves many procedures in Tally ERP 9.

Tally Prime minimises the procedures.

This ensures faster results.

 

5. Interface

The interface of Tally ERP 9 looks old-fashioned.

The interface of Tally Prime looks new and attractive.

An uncluttered screen helps reduce confusion.

 

6. Multi-tasking

Multi-tasking features are somewhat restrictive in Tally ERP 9.

However, Tally Prime offers improved multi-tasking features.

Users can perform multiple tasks without switching windows.

 

7. Assistance and Guidance

Assistance provided by Tally ERP 9 on-screen is minimal.

On-screen guidance is available in Tally Prime.

This helps novices learn effectively.
